How to Replace Damaged Boat Badges Properly

A faded chrome emblem, cracked nameplate, or lifting decal can make an otherwise well-kept vessel look overdue for a refit. Knowing how to replace damaged boat badges is about more than covering the old footprint. The right replacement needs to suit the hull, survive the marine environment, and look intentionally fitted from every angle at the dock.

A badge may be a model emblem, a builder mark, a tender logo, or the vessel name itself. Each calls for a slightly different approach, but the same standard applies: remove the failed piece cleanly, confirm what is underneath, and install a replacement that belongs on the boat.

Start by Identifying What Kind of Badge You Have

Before ordering anything, establish how the existing badge is attached. Most boat badges fall into three categories: adhesive-mounted emblems, stud-mounted cast badges, and vinyl or painted graphics. A backlit name or logo may also have concealed wiring and mounting pins.

Adhesive-mounted emblems are common on production boats and are usually the simplest to remove without drilling. Stud-mounted badges require more care because their fasteners may be accessible from inside a locker, behind an interior panel, or within the transom structure. Never assume a badge can be pulled free just because no screws are visible.

Take clear, straight-on photographs and record the overall width and height. Then measure the spacing between letters, the distance from nearby rub rail, vents, seams, or hardware, and the position of any mounting holes. A close measurement is useful, but a full-size template or dimensional drawing is better when matching an existing location.

There is also an important distinction between cosmetic branding and required information. Do not remove or alter a hull identification number, capacity plate, registration marking, safety label, or federally required certification plate as part of a badge replacement. Those components have specific compliance requirements and are not decorative signage.

How to Replace Damaged Boat Badges Without Damaging the Gelcoat

The removal process determines whether the new badge looks factory-fitted or becomes a repair project. Heat, patience, and the right tools are more valuable than force.

For an adhesive emblem, warm a small section with a hair dryer or controlled low-heat gun. The goal is to soften the adhesive, not overheat the gelcoat, paint, or surrounding laminate. Keep the heat moving and avoid working on a hot hull in direct sun, where surface temperatures are already elevated.

Use fishing line, monofilament, or a plastic trim tool to separate the badge from the surface. Metal scrapers are risky on gelcoat and painted finishes. Work gradually from an edge instead of trying to pry the entire emblem away in one motion.

Once the badge is off, adhesive residue often remains. A marine-safe adhesive remover can help, but test it first in an inconspicuous location. Follow with a mild soap wash, then inspect the area in angled light. Old emblems can leave a visible outline because the surrounding gelcoat has weathered while the covered area has not.

That shadow does not always require a major correction. Light oxidation may respond to a careful compound and polish. On older boats, however, a replacement badge that is slightly different in size can expose a permanent color difference. This is where precise replacement sizing matters. Matching the original footprint is often the cleanest option, while deliberately choosing a larger, more refined badge can be the better solution when the old outline cannot be corrected.

Check for Hidden Fasteners and Old Holes

If the badge has studs, remove interior nuts or retaining clips before applying pressure from the exterior. Corroded hardware may need penetrating oil and time. Forcing a stud through brittle fiberglass can chip gelcoat around the hole.

After removal, inspect every hole. If the replacement uses the same pattern, dry-fit it before adding adhesive or sealant. If the new badge does not use the old holes, fill and finish them properly. A quick dab of sealant may keep water out temporarily, but it will not create a clean, lasting finish on a visible surface.

For transom-mounted signs, any penetration below or near water-exposure areas should be sealed with the correct marine bedding method. The right approach depends on the substrate, access behind the panel, and whether the hardware must be serviceable later.

Choose a Replacement Built for the Conditions

A boat badge lives in sun, spray, washdowns, vibration, and temperature swings. That makes material selection more than a style decision.

Vinyl can be an effective choice for temporary identification, simple registration numbers, or a low-profile graphic. It is economical and has no holes to drill, but it can fade, shrink, or lift over time depending on film quality, surface preparation, and exposure. It is not the same visual or structural solution as fabricated marine lettering.

For a permanent premium badge, 316L stainless steel is a strong choice. It offers excellent corrosion resistance for marine use and delivers the crisp edges, depth, and finish expected on a quality vessel. Brushed, polished, black-coated, and custom-color treatments can all work, but the finish should complement nearby rails, hardware, and hull color rather than compete with them.

Acrylic and plastic emblems can be appropriate for some applications, particularly where weight or cost is the priority. The trade-off is longevity and perceived finish. On a yacht transom, hardtop, or visible hullside, a fabricated stainless-steel badge generally holds its appearance better and creates a more substantial result.

If the replacement includes illumination, specify marine-grade LED components, wire exits, and a voltage configuration appropriate for the vessel. The sign should be designed around its mounting surface, not adapted at the last minute after fabrication. A well-planned backlit name has controlled wire routing, a clear mounting layout, and a lighting effect that remains legible without harsh hot spots.

Match the Design Before You Commit to Fabrication

Replacing a damaged badge is an opportunity to correct what did not work the first time. Maybe the original letters were too small to read from the dock, the builder logo no longer reflects the vessel's refit, or the old material simply did not withstand the environment.

Still, replacement does not always mean redesign. Owners restoring a classic boat may want an exact reproduction, including original letter spacing and period-correct styling. A newer yacht may benefit from a refreshed typeface, dimensional lettering, or subtle halo lighting. It depends on whether the objective is authenticity, visibility, or a full visual upgrade.

Ask for production artwork and dimensional drawings before fabrication begins. Confirm the overall dimensions, individual letter spacing, thickness, finish, mounting method, and wire locations if illuminated. This documentation is particularly valuable when a captain, yard, or installer will be completing the work instead of the owner.

Prepare the Surface for a Lasting Installation

A premium badge will only adhere as well as the surface beneath it. After removing residue and correcting any old holes, wash the area thoroughly. Then wipe it with the surface-prep product recommended for the adhesive system being used. Wax, silicone, polish oils, and salt residue can all interfere with bond strength.

Dry-fit the badge first. Use low-tack painter's tape to establish a level reference line and center point. On a curved transom, do not rely solely on a tape measure taken from one edge. Step back several times and assess the placement from normal viewing distance. A sign can be mathematically centered and still look off when nearby trim lines or hull geometry are asymmetrical.

For adhesive-mounted lettering, apply pressure evenly and follow the adhesive manufacturer's cure guidance. Do not wash the boat immediately afterward. For stud-mounted or illuminated badges, confirm all mounting points and wire routes before final placement. Once a sign is bedded and wired, repositioning is rarely simple.

Do Not Rush Electrical Connections

An illuminated badge should be connected through a properly protected circuit, with appropriate fusing and marine-grade connections. Keep splices accessible where possible and protect wire runs from chafe, water intrusion, and strain. If the wiring path involves the transom, structural panels, or unfamiliar DC systems, a qualified marine electrician or experienced installer is the sensible choice.

Test the illumination before final sealing and again after the installation is complete. Check the sign at dusk as well as in full darkness. The goal is elegant, even light that identifies the vessel without overwhelming the surrounding finish.
